The Catholic Charities, Diocese of Joliet Mobile Food Pantry is a traveling food pantry that delivers nutritious food (meat, produce and nonperishable items) to people in need. Participants are asked to bring bags, laundry baskets, boxes, carts or wagons to transport your food and grocery products through the line and back to your vehicle. A representative from Catholic Charities, Diocese of Joliet will be available at the Mobile Food Pantry to explain the services provided by the agency, including:
· vouchers for food, travel, clothing and furniture
· financial assistance for prescription medication, rent and mortgage
· information and referral to other community resources
